Residential Programs
Comprehensive care, education, recreation and family-focused therapy and aftercare help youth re-engage with their homes, schools and communities. CJR provides residential care for boys on its Litchfield campus and short-term, crisis intervention for girls at its Center for Assessment, Respite and Enrichment (CARE) in Waterbury.

Group Homes
The Connecticut Junior Republic's East Hartford and Winchester Group Homes provide a therapeutic, home-like environment for youth transitioning from residential placement to the community.

Education
The Cable Academic and Vocational Education Center on CJR's Litchfield campus provides special, vocational and alternative education as well as transition and related services for special needs and at risk students from public school districts.

Community Programs
CJR provides numerous preventive and early intervention programs to help meet the needs of today's youth and families through its community programs located in Danbury, Meriden, New Britain, New Haven, Torrington and Waterbury.
